About the Role:

For AHP1 Level:

  • Work under the guidance of a Senior Physiotherapist to deliver a broad spectrum of health services to meet local community needs.
  • Collaborate with the Regional Community Health Team Leader within a multidisciplinary framework, applying various strategies for preventive care, early interventions, treatments, and evaluations.
  • Engage in a comprehensive approach to address community health concerns effectively.

For AHP2 Level:

  • Utilise your extensive clinical expertise to design, implement, and assess a wide range of services tailored to community needs.
  • Work autonomously with minimal clinical direction, overseeing the development of junior allied health professionals, assistants, and students.
  • Collaborate within multidisciplinary teams, employing a holistic approach that includes preventive measures, early interventions, individual therapy, group programs, health promotion initiatives, and community development projects.

The Region

The Eyre and Far North Local Health Network (EFNLHN) covers almost 340,000 square kilometres of spectacular South Australia, supporting about 40,000 people living around Eyre Peninsula and the Far North of the state.

With its ancient outback landscapes and culture, boutique vineyards, renowned oyster farms and Australia’s best-kept-secret surf coast, the Eyre Peninsula and Far North offers a lifestyle that will inspire and energise you.  The region enjoys a Mediterranean style climate so there’s plenty of opportunity to enjoy everything the region has to offer.
